"Park Scene By Adolphe Monticelli 1824-1886"
Large and beautiful oil on wood representing a Park scene around 1865 signed lower right MONTICELLI dimensions 41cm x 100cm plus wooden frame of the Montparnasse type in carved and patinated wood 65cm x 124cm This painting from the very creative period of the artist, called Scottish, very appreciated by the Anglo-Saxons who saw in Monticelli an innovator, creator, of the same level as Willian TURNER Certificate of Authenticity from Mr marc STAMMEGNA Very interesting work of this great painter who is part of the great creators of modern art of the 19th century with Cézanne and Van GOGH Adolphe Monticelli whose works appear in the greatest museums around the world as well as in prestigious collections His record price being 413,000 USD in 2013 for a small landscape bordering on abstraction and a bouquet of flowers made 208,000 euros in 2022 Van GOGH had a revelation when he saw works by Monticelli at his brother Theo's house. He wrote "I owe everything to Monticelli, he who taught me the chromatism of colors." The painting that I am presenting to you is a very beautiful collector's work, extremely modern for the time, pure spots placed with precision (a harbinger of both impressionism, fauvism and abstraction) on wood left bare in places to give a background color.
